Josephiesta 2025: A blend of cultural activities and academic competitions

Besides mesmerising group dance, and a moving musical performance by college choir, the event also saw dance competitions, an open mic session, and food stalls

Hyderabad: Students from all across Hyderabad took part in the vibrant annual celebration, Josephiesta 2025, which took place at St. Joseph’s Degree and PG College here on Friday. This year’s event was a blend of cultural performances and academic competitions, fostering a spirit of unity and creativity among the participants.

Delivering the presidential address, Principal Anthony Sagayaraja said the event was a platform to showcase the hidden talents of the youngsters.


“Failures should never stop the student from reaching the destination. A continuous effort by not focusing on the failures should be the norm for the youngsters,” he underscored, adding failures would rather help an individual to learn.

During the event, students showcased their talents through a mesmerising group dance, while the college choir provided a moving musical performance that resonated with the audience.

Adding to the festive atmosphere were stalls offering a variety of food, handmade accessories, and products from local small businesses. Events such as dance competitions and an open mic session allowing students to showcase their diverse talents, were also organised.
